Paytm braces for near-term Ebitda impact as digital payment infra incentive lapses(Soban News)

The PIDF incentive, which contributed ₹216 crore over the nine months ended December 2025, expired in December and will not recur. Paytm will also have to shield tax on other income from the coming financial year, analysts said.
